Discounts are available for veterans, first responders, educators, and students, and The Naples Players continues to offer a \"Pay What You Can\" program to ensure access for all members of the community.For more information about Season 73, subscriptions, or programs, visit: naplesplayers.org/season73.ABOUT THE NAPLES PLAYERSFounded in 1953, The Naples Players is a nationally recognized community theatre dedicated to building community through exceptional access to the power of theatre. Located in the heart of downtown Naples, The Naples Players engages more than 850 volunteers annually and reaches over 70,000 audience members and students through high-quality productions, inclusive education programs, and innovative community partnerships. The Naples Players is home to the Baker Day School of the Academy of Dramatic Arts, the only full-time performing arts school in Southwest Florida. With a newly renovated, LEED-certified facility, The Naples Players continues to serve as a cultural hub and leader in how theatres can impact their communities. The world's most prestigious indoor/outdoor garden festival blooms again for the 113th year starting May 19 in London under the direction of the Royal Horticultural Society. The RHS Chelsea Flower Show was officially dedicated by Queen Alexandra, wife of King Edward VII in 1913. It encompasses 20 acres of grounds surrounding The Royal Hospital Chelsea, a stunning residential estate designed by renowned architect Christopher Wren in 1692 as a retirement home for veterans of the British Army. Attended by the highest echelons of British society, including the Royal Family, horticulturists and enthusiasts from around the world, its tickets sell out far in advance, and at approximately US $150-plus, most would happily pay more. But even without a ticket, visitors flock to London for the adjacent floral extravaganza that every year seems to escape farther beyond the walls of the show like fastgrowing tendrils of wisteria into London's most iconic shopping and dining districts: Chelsea, Belgravia and Mayfair. Hundreds of businesses from posh hotels, restaurants and fashion houses to banks and bakeries sprout floral extravagance on their facades, drenching windows and spilling onto the sidewalks. Many also transform their interiors into Instagram-perfect environments. The official dates are May 18-24, wrapped an extra day on each side of the RHS Chelsea Flower Show. The price to immerse and gawk at the spectacular displays? Free!London in Bloom Flower ShowKAREN T. Photo by Chris Mundie Lay Right: Three hundred retired soldiers called Chelsea Pensioners live on the site of the RHS Chelsea Flower Show. During official occasions the highly esteemed men and women wear their iconic scarlet uniforms.
Each year top designers vie for the honor of creating the dozen or more main themed gardens. Hundreds of additional designers and vendors showcase smaller gardens and wondrous floral designs along the Main Avenue, down forested trails and limestone walkways, over footbridges, and alongside terraced walls. Blooms spill from every conceivable structure or container, from a replica English cottage and crumbling stone ruins to exotic water gardens and the soaring, three-acre Great Pavilion, anchored by the breathtaking experience of a David Austin Rose Garden. Among the most anticipated 2026 presentations is Tokonoma Garden - Samumaya no Niwa, a nostalgic Japanese tea garden. Patrons also are buzzing about the potential showstopper this year: the romantic Boodles Garden, inspired by features of four historic royal palaces, including The Tower of London. (which is officially named His Majesty's Royal Palace and Fortress of the Tower of London). Throughout the show are ideas for sensory gardens, herb gardens, bonsai gardens and apartment-size balcony gardens, and scores of artful discoveries secreted among the plantings. From lush expanses of verdant greens to outrageous bursts of color, plantings are incorporated into alcoves, intertwined as living sculptures and topiaries, bursting forth from artisanal pots, and generating oohs and aahs at inspired vendor displays. Foodie options include champagne breakfasts, high teas, street food, picnic items and intimate cafes. For the most discriminating of tastes, there's Spring Garden, an exclusive all-day, reservationonly, multi-meal experience showcasing the culinary artistry of Michelin-starred chef Jeremy Chan of Ikoyi and renowned Spanish chef José Pizarro. Prices range from US $1,000 - $1,500. Regarding discriminating tastes, one thing that most decidedly will not be seen at the Chelsea Flower Show is a gnome. Not one. Ever. The kitschy little creatures enjoyed one brief year (2013), which was quite enough, thank you, for RHS members and patrons. Shopping also is an indulgence, with thousands of flower-themed gifts, books, art and photography for sale, plus a big plant sell-off on the final day. Proceeds from the show are distributed among several charities. 54 | Old Naples News April 2026CHELSEA IN BLOOMLast year the Chelsea district was awash in fashion and flowers. In stark contrast, Chelsea in Bloom 2026 will be out of this world. Literally. Well, not literally-literally, but the displays along posh King's Road and Sloane Street will be an \"intergalactic wonderland of creativity, drawing on astrology, mythology, spiritual symbolism, and celestial magic.\" A dazzling zodiac constellation will take over Sloane Square; a UFO will land on Pavilion Road; and Duke of York Square will become an immersive lunar landscape, with tantalizing new reveals weekly. More than 130 businesses, including Ralph Lauren, Lululemon, and the Sloane Square Hotel pull out all the creative stops to transform their facades into living, fragrant (and this year, outrageous) art. Best tube station: Sloane Square. BELGRAVIA IN BLOOM Fairy Tales in Belgravia is the 2026 theme for this charming, haute couture and design district’s streets and public squares, especially around affluent Elizabeth Street, Motcomb Street, Eccleston Yards and Pimlico Road. Expect magical, colorful, and oh-so-adorable photo ops at more than 50 retailers, including Philip Treacy, an excellent source for your next Hats in the Garden fascinator. Best tube stations: Knightsbridge and Sloane Square.MAYFAIR IN BLOOM: A smaller version of Chelsea and Belgravia's shows, this ultra-luxe shopping mecca in London's West End (think Gucci, Louis Vuitton, Cartier, Christian Louboutin and Saville Row) commands its spot on next month's flower-infused walking tour. Annabel's is a private club, but it's free to gawk at its jaw-dropping floral facade. Reserve a table for high tea at Sketch, the famous, \"must-do-once\" whimsical restaurant, which kicks it up another notch each year with a new level of immersive floral presentations.
